2026 Doctoral Candidates in Finance at Technical University of Munich

Subscribe for Scholarship Alert!

Being one of the best faculties in Economics in Germany, the TUM School of Management is building a unique bridge between Management and Technology within an international teaching and learning environment. The newly established Chair of Digital Finance is looking for Doctoral Candidates.

Your Responsibilities:

  • Successful candidates will work under the supervision of Prof. Dr. Florian Weigert on research projects in Asset Pricing, Investments, Behavioral Finance, Financial Risk Management, or Financial Technology
  • Participation in the Ph.D. program of the TUM School of Management
  • Support the teaching activities of the Chair of Digital Finance
  • Work on third-party funded projects

Benefits

  • A stimulating, dynamic and multi-disciplinary research environment in one of the world’s leading universities
  • Diverse and demanding job at the intersection of Finance and Technology
  • 75% position; remuneration will be based on the Collective Agreement for the Civil Service of the Länder (E13 TV-L)
  • The positions are limited to a duration of four years

Requirements

  • Candidates should have completed (or are completing) a Master’s degree (or equivalent) in Finance, Management/Business, Economics, Mathematics, or Information Systems
  • Superior academic track record
  • Enthusiasm for conducting high-quality and innovative empirical research in Asset Pricing, Investments, Behavioral Finance, Financial Risk Management, or Financial Technology
  • Strong statistical training and quantitative research methods; profound knowledge in machine learning techniques is an advantage
  • Experience with programming languages, such as R, Python, or Stata
  • Excellent English language skills; German language skills are an advantage

Application Documents

  • Motivation letter
  • Detailed CV
  • Degrees and transcripts
  • GMAT/GRE scores (not mandatory)
  • IELTS/TOEFL scores (not mandatory)
  • Writing sample (not mandatory)

Application Deadline

May 22, 2026

How To Apply

  • Send your application by email in a single PDF to [email protected], quoting the keyword “Digital Finance”.
